Thornless Blackberry Plant | Rubus fruticosus 'Waldo'
- The size of these blackberries is truly something to marvel at. Where's Waldo?! You must be having a laugh because, believe us, there's no missing these jumbo berries...
- 'Waldo' forms a dense, compact blackberry bush with masses of large, plump berries and no thorns! Perfect for soft fruit growing in a confined space.
- This cultivar performs well in a sunny spot (or with partial shade). It thrives grown against a sunny wall, or fence, and can even be grown in a container.
- The flavour really is exquisite, too, bursting with a fruity, tangy taste that offers just the right levels of sweetness. They're perfect for making pies!
- A very reliable cropper, you can expect to see impressive yields, even from a young plant. Harvest from late August through to September.
